NatRules interface
Interface die een NatRules vertegenwoordigt.
Methoden
| begin |
Hiermee maakt u een NAT-regel naar een schaalbare VPN-gateway als deze niet bestaat, worden de bestaande NAT-regels bijgewerkt. |
| begin |
Hiermee maakt u een NAT-regel naar een schaalbare VPN-gateway als deze niet bestaat, worden de bestaande NAT-regels bijgewerkt. |
| begin |
Hiermee verwijdert u een NAT-regel. |
| begin |
Hiermee verwijdert u een NAT-regel. |
| get(string, string, string, Nat |
Haalt de details van een nat ruleGet op. |
| list |
Hiermee worden alle NAT-regels opgehaald voor een bepaalde vpn-gateway voor een virtuele wan. |
Methodedetails
beginCreateOrUpdate(string, string, string, VpnGatewayNatRule, NatRulesCreateOrUpdateOptionalParams)
Hiermee maakt u een NAT-regel naar een schaalbare VPN-gateway als deze niet bestaat, worden de bestaande NAT-regels bijgewerkt.
function beginCreateOrUpdate(resourceGroupName: string, gatewayName: string, natRuleName: string, natRuleParameters: VpnGatewayNatRule, options?: NatRulesC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<VpnGatewayNatRule>, VpnGatewayNatRule>>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ep van de VpnGateway.
- gatewayName
-
string
De naam van de gateway.
- natRuleName
-
string
De naam van de nat-regel.
- natRuleParameters
- VpnGatewayNatRule
Parameters die zijn opgegeven om een Nat-regel te maken of bij te werken.
De optiesparameters.
Retouren
Promise<@azure/core-lro.SimplePollerLike<OperationState<VpnGatewayNatRule>, VpnGatewayNatRule>>
beginCreateOrUpdateAndWait(string, string, string, VpnGatewayNatRule, NatRulesCreateOrUpdateOptionalParams)
Hiermee maakt u een NAT-regel naar een schaalbare VPN-gateway als deze niet bestaat, worden de bestaande NAT-regels bijgewerkt.
function beginCreateOrUpdateAndWait(resourceGroupName: string, gatewayName: string, natRuleName: string, natRuleParameters: VpnGatewayNatRule, options?: NatRulesCreateOrUpdateOptionalParams): Promise<VpnGatewayNatRule>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ep van de VpnGateway.
- gatewayName
-
string
De naam van de gateway.
- natRuleName
-
string
De naam van de nat-regel.
- natRuleParameters
- VpnGatewayNatRule
Parameters die zijn opgegeven om een Nat-regel te maken of bij te werken.
De optiesparameters.
Retouren
Promise<VpnGatewayNatRule>
beginDelete(string, string, string, NatRulesDeleteOptionalParams)
Hiermee verwijdert u een NAT-regel.
function beginDelete(resourceGroupName: string, gatewayName: string, natRuleName: string, options?: NatRules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ep van de VpnGateway.
- gatewayName
-
string
De naam van de gateway.
- natRuleName
-
string
De naam van de nat-regel.
- options
- NatRulesDeleteOptionalParams
De optiesparameters.
Retouren
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>
beginDeleteAndWait(string, string, string, NatRulesDeleteOptionalParams)
Hiermee verwijdert u een NAT-regel.
function beginDeleteAndWait(resourceGroupName: string, gatewayName: string, natRuleName: string, options?: NatRulesDeleteOptionalParams): Promise<void>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ep van de VpnGateway.
- gatewayName
-
string
De naam van de gateway.
- natRuleName
-
string
De naam van de nat-regel.
- options
- NatRulesDeleteOptionalParams
De optiesparameters.
Retouren
Promise<void>
get(string, string, string, NatRulesGetOptionalParams)
Haalt de details van een nat ruleGet op.
function get(resourceGroupName: string, gatewayName: string, natRuleName: string, options?: NatRulesGetOptionalParams): Promise<VpnGatewayNatRule>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ep van de VpnGateway.
- gatewayName
-
string
De naam van de gateway.
- natRuleName
-
string
De naam van de nat-regel.
- options
- NatRulesGetOptionalParams
De optiesparameters.
Retouren
Promise<VpnGatewayNatRule>
listByVpnGateway(string, string, NatRulesListByVpnGatewayOptionalParams)
Hiermee worden alle NAT-regels opgehaald voor een bepaalde vpn-gateway voor een virtuele wan.
function listByVpnGateway(resourceGroupName: string, gatewayName: string, options?: NatRulesListByVpnGatewayOptionalParams): PagedAsyncIterableIterator<VpnGatewayNatRule, VpnGatewayNatRule[], PageSettings>
Parameters
- resourceGroupName
-
string
De naam van de resourcegroep van de VpnGateway.
- gatewayName
-
string
De naam van de gateway.
De optiesparameters.